Robust Observer Design for Polytopic Discrete-Time Nonlinear Descriptor Systems (2207.04290v1)
Abstract: This paper considers the design of robust state observers for a class of slope-restricted nonlinear descriptor systems with unknown time-varying parameters belonging to a known set. The proposed design accounts for process disturbances and measurement noise, while allowing for a trade-off between transient performance and sensitivity to noise and parameter mismatch. We exploit a polytopic structure of the system to derive linear-matrix-inequality-based synthesis conditions for robust parameter-dependent observers for the entire parameter set. In addition, we present (alternative) necessary and sufficient synthesis conditions for an important subclass within the considered class of systems and we show the effectiveness of the design for a numerical case study.
